Abstract

In accounting, there are two methods used in recording business combinations i.e purchase and pooling of interest method. Purchase method has ameasurable indication with the withdrawal of cash beside the cost of business combination and stock issuance costs incurred by the company buyer. In addition to that, there will be changes of ownership. The assets acquired by a business entity are recorded and recognized at market value. As a consequence, the excess of fixed assets will be recorded as goodwill. Meanwhile if the business combination uses the pooling of interest method, then the amount of assets, debts and rights of shareholders that are reported by the affiliated companies will be recognized in accordance with its book value. APB No.16 notes that there are 12 requirements that must be met when using pooling of interest method. If it does not meet any of these requirements then the combined companies must use the purchase method. There is no goodwill in pooling interest method. It means that in the merger process there is no obligation to pay taxes since it based on book value and no goodwill.

Abstract

This study aims to analyze the influence of financial indicators (CAR, FDR, BOPO, NIM, NPF) and non-financial (number of bank offices, market share, GCG, CSR) on profitability that is proxied by Return on Assets (ROA) of Islamic Banks in 2014 -2018. The data source used is secondary data from 2014-2018. Data analysis techniques used are descriptive analysis, multiple linear regression analysis and the classic assumption test. Findings. The results of the study are that CAR does not have a significant negative effect. FDR does not have a significant negative directional effect. BOPO has a significant negative effect. NIM has a positive positive significant effect. NPF has a significant negative effect. The number of bank offices has no significant positive effect. Market share does not have a significant negative directional effect. GCG does not have a significant negative effect. CSR has a significant negative effect. The adjusted R2 value is 73.21% while the remaining 26.79% is influenced by other variables outside the study so the researcher should further add other variables.

Abstract

This study aims to examine the effect of interdependence mechanisms of corporate governance on company performance (Agrawal and Knoeber 1996). These mechanisms are: managerial ownership, institutional ownership, independent commissioner, board size, debt policy, dividend policy, market concentration, and market share with the control variables are growth, size, and firm ages. Test results on 349 firm-years using OLS regression for each mechanism and 2SLS regression for simultaneous testing indicate the presence of interdependence between the mechanisms. both parsial and simultanously; managerial ownership and dividend policy does not significantly influence on the banking efficiency. Significant positive effect of the board size and institutional ownership when tested by OLS did not recur when tested simultaneously using 2SLS. Instead, the independent commissioner when tested by 2SLS have significant negative effect but using OLS no significant effect. There are three variables of corporate governance mechanisms have consistent effect on the banking efficiency; debt policy has significant negative effect, while the market concentration and market share have significant positive effect. Different results between the tests using OLS and 2SLS emphasize the interdependence of these mechanisms is also shown that application of the policy of corporate governance mechanisms should be done carefully so that the expected performance can be achieved.

Abstract

This article aims to present an analysis of the influence of digital banks on bank profitability in Indonesia in 2013–2021. The research method used is a comparative causal method with secondary data from annual reports of sample banks taken purposively from banks in Indonesia that have provided digital bank transaction services and have gone public from 2013–2021. The results show that the number of digital bank transactions in the form of mobile banking (MB) has a positive effect on bank profitability by controlling liquidity (LDR). This happens because MB transactions are emergency and simple with smaller transaction limits so that the number of MB transactions is large and in line with increasing operational efficiency and bank profitability, and the number of digital bank transactions in the form of Internet banking does not affect bank profitability even though it has controlled liquidity (LDR). ). This is because IB transactions are complex with a nominal limit per transaction that is larger than MB, so the number of IB transactions is smaller than the number of MB transactions. Abstract

This study aims to analyze strategic taxpayer compliance during the Covid-19 pandemic at the Medan Madya Dua Tax Office using quantitative methods. The research population is 1,966 taxpayers, consisting of 1,800 corporate taxpayers and 166 individual taxpayers. Independent variables include tax incentives, tax counseling, tax sanctions, supervision by Account Representative (AR), and tax audits, while the dependent variable is taxpayer compliance. Data were measured using dummy variables and nominal scales, and analyzed by multinomial logistic regression. The results showed that tax sanctions with a fine category of more than 2,000,000 tended to make taxpayers report tax returns on time with a probability of 59.63% higher than those on time. AR supervision with the SP2DK issuance category also increases the probability of late SPT reporting by 59.23%. The study shows that the variables of incentives, counseling, sanctions, AR supervision, and tax audits significantly affect taxpayer compliance in reporting annual tax returns. Abstract

Bookkeeping is one of the activities in financial management in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ises (MSMEs) as an effort to improve the quality of financial reporting. The low quality of MSME financial reporting impacts other problems, such as reduced productivity and constraints on other MSME business processes. MSMEs experience this in Parung Serab Village, Tangerang. Parung Serab MSMEs experienced a decline in productivity due to a need for more consistency in reporting and financial management. Moreover, due to inconsistent financial management, MSMEs cannot open up and improve their finances, resulting in losses. Due to this problem, the team serves the community by assisting in simple bookkeeping using Microsoft Excel tools. This community service activity aims to improve the quality of MSME financial reporting through simple bookkeeping using a mentoring approach. This qualitative study uses data about the problems faced by MSMEs collected through an interview process. The subjects of this assistance are 15 MSMEs in Parung Serab, Ciledug. The result of this assistance is that with simple bookkeeping using Microsoft Excel format, MSMEs in Parung Serab have succeeded in maintaining consistency in financial management and reporting. This assistance means that by maintaining consistency in financial management, the quality of financial management and reporting and the productivity of MSMEs will increase.
